There was a story of a couple who'd been dating for five years. 
One cool Valentine morning, the guy drove the girl to work. 

Then she gently held his hand and told him, 
“I had a strange dream last night. 
You gave me a pearl necklace for Valentine's Day. 
What do you think it means?” 

He smiled and with a twinkle in his eyes he tenderly replied, 
“You'll know tonight,” 

That evening, they went out for dinner. 
And before the night ended, the guy was starry-eyed when he lovingly handed his gift to her. Delighted, she slowly untied the red ribbon, careful not tear what looked like an expensive wrapper. 

By the time she saw the wooden box engraved with words that said, 
“Especially for You,” tears begin to roll down her soft cheeks. 
She was choking with emotion and said, 
'Oh darling, you didn't have to.” 

Teary-eyed, he adoringly replied,
“Open it.” 
Inside it was a book entitled “The Meaning of Dreams.”
